A great start to the new year was had by all at Your Dekalb Farmer's Market on the 1st of January. SO much better than Whole Foods in Buckhead. What could be better than an excited crowd of people from all over the world in a large 60 degree warehouse, lots of draped fabrics, turbans (Caroline Pittman) and the scent of old fish, but yet a good welcome home old-fish sort of smell. Or is that only what people say who have lived abroad in non-Westernized countries and come to love them?

Among my purchases: some Dutch cow's milk cheese, Spanish wine and of course, Kenyan coffee.
